The Piano

Sampled from a nearly new Hailun H‑1P, this upright was recorded in the inviting acoustics of a small living room. The environment keeps the sound close and immediate, making every note feel like it’s played right in front of you. Its youthful condition means the action is responsive, the tone even across the range, and every nuance of the performance is faithfully conveyed. That slight upright character gives it personality, while its overall cleanliness makes it versatile enough for both modern and traditional settings.

Technical Details

Microphone Positions

Front Under

A pair of Omni-directional condenser mics underneath the keyboard facing the bridge. Provides a clear, crisp, intimate sound with very light hammer action noise.

Behind Close

A pair of cardioid microphones near the soundboard behind the piano. This gives that characteristic sound of an upright piano while still being close and wide.

Behind Spaced

Pulled back a couple feet from the back side of the soundboard. This gives a more spacious and natural sound, with a bright crisp tone.

Front Over

A wide pair of microphones aiming at the hammers. Despite what you may expect, this position gives a dark, distant, but wide tone.

Room

A pair of spaced omni-directional microphones about 6 feet away from the piano. These capture the entire piano and the room. This position gives a more distant sound and works best blended with the other microphone positions.

All of your Boz Digital Labs pianos are hosted in a single plugin: Master Keys. Master Keys is a dedicated plugin specifically designed specialize in playing pianos that both sound and feel natural. It gives you the effects and control you need to personalize your piano sound to match your vibe.

Master Keys includes a built in 6-band parametric EQ, algorithmic reverb and channel mixing controls.
